As an artist who has ADHD, making decisions can be difficult at times, especially when it comes to creating.
In July, I posted an S.O.S. video on my TikTok and YouTube, asking what types of animals I should draw next.
At the time, I realized I'd been drawing the same few animals over and over again. It was to the point of hyper fixation; the amount of bunny-styled stickers available in my shop at the moment is insane.
However, after posting my S.O.S. video, I received an incredible amount of responses sharing what they wanted me to draw.
When I tell you I received so many comments that I was becoming overwhelmed with decision paralysis, I'm not joking.
That was until one of you suggested the random selection method, which entails that I write all the suggestions down onto slips of paper, fold them up, and put them into a bowl to choose from.
A genius idea, by the way!
So, that's what I did. Cue the new series called, "Will it Stick Leg?"
The moment I have the energy to draw, I grab a piece of paper from the cupped hands dish and complete a few sketches.
The goal is to create a sketch, turn it into a complete concept, and then make stickers of the design. How many stickers, you might ask? Currently, I don't know. At the moment, I'm just enjoying the fact that I don't have to put much thought into what I'm drawing, only that I'm drawing something.
So far, I've drawn thirteen different animals; most have stick legs, some are horrific, and one... is currently fighting me.
